SQL限流 rds_ccl AliPG提供的自研插件rds_ccl可以进行SQL限流,通过限制并发SQL数,从而避免过高的数据库负载,保证数据库的稳定性和可靠性,提高数据库的性能和效率,从而更好地支持业务需求。逻辑订阅故障转移 Failover Slot 社区版...
PolarDB MySQL版 优化了B-tree索引的并发控制机制,有效地提升了高并发读写场景下的性能。本文介绍了B-tree并发控制优化的使用方法和使用该机制的限制和前提条件等内容。背景信息 InnoDB引擎使用索引来组织表结构,每张表的数据均放在一个...
为了应对突发的数据库请求流量、资源消耗过高的语句访问以及SQL访问模型的变化,保证MySQL实例持续稳定运行,阿里云提供基于语句规则的并发控制CCL(Concurrency Control),并提供了工具包(DBMS_CCL)便于您快捷使用。前提条件 实例版本...
为了应对突发的数据库请求流量、资源消耗过高的SQL语句以及SQL语句访问模型变化问题,保证 PolarDB 集群持续稳定运行,阿里云提供了基于SQL语句的并发控制Concurrency Control(简称CCL)规则,并提供了工具包 DBMS_CCL 便于您快捷地使用该...
一些 DDL 命令(当前只有TRUNCATE和表重写形式的ALTER TABLE)对于 MVCC 不是安全的。这意味着在截断或者重写提交之后,该表将对并发事务...相比之下,显式检查系统目录的查询不会看到表示并发创建的数据库对象的行,在更高的隔离级别中。
尽管本数据库提供对表数据访问的非阻塞读/写,但并非本数据库中实现的每一个索引访问方法当前都能够提供非阻塞读/写访问。B-tree、GiST 和 SP-GiST索引:短期的页面级共享/排他锁被用于读/写访问。每个索引行被取得或被插入后立即释放锁。...
您可以在本地设备或ECS实例中安装Mongodump和Mongorestore(也可以安装MongoDB数据库)工具,然后使用这些工具将MongoDB Atlas数据库迁移至阿里云数据库MongoDB。说明 本文以本地设备为例介绍操作流程。注意事项 确保安装的Mongodump和...
在本数据库中,来自于其他环境的被编写成使用可序列化事务来保证一致性的软件应该“只工作”在这一点上。当使用这种技术时,如果应用软件通过一个框架来自动重试由于序列化错误而回滚的事务,它将避免为应用程序员带来不必要的负担。把 ...
图数据库(Graph Database)使用服务关联角色获取其他云服务或云资源的访问权限。通常情况下,服务关联角色是在您执行某项操作时,由系统自动创建。在自动创建服务关联角色失败或 图数据库 不支持自动创建时,您需要手动创建服务关联角色。...
本数据库提供了多种锁模式用于控制对表中数据的并发访问。这些模式可以用于在 MVCC 无法给出期望行为的情境中由应用控制的锁。同样,大多数本数据库命令会自动要求恰当的锁以保证被引用的表在命令的执行过程中不会以一种不兼容的方式删除或...
表 2.connection-option(控制数据库连接参数命令行选项)命令行选项 描述-d dbname 即-dbname=dbname 指定要连接的数据库的名称。h host 即-host=host 指定运行服务器的计算机的主机名。如果该值以斜杠开头,则将其用作Unix域套接字的目录...
支持 支持 SQL 限流 应用侧的并发陡增,经常导致数据库并发过高从而影响性能。这种情况下,一般都是少量的重复SQL在执行。PolarDB 可以限制某一类SQL同时执行的个数,来避免单条SQL压垮整个数据库。支持 支持 Fast Startup 快速启动优化。...
背景 为了让不熟悉SQL语言的用户能方便地从数据库中取数分析,PolarDB for AI联合达摩院推出自研的自然语言到数据库查询语言转义(Nature Language To SQL,简称 NL2SQL)能力。PolarDB for AI会将用户输入的自然语言(中文或英文)自动...
背景 为了让不熟悉SQL语言的用户能方便地从数据库中取数分析,PolarDB for AI联合达摩院推出自研的自然语言到数据库查询语言转义(Nature Language To SQL,简称 NL2SQL)能力。PolarDB for AI会将用户输入的自然语言(中文或英文)自动...
RDS PostgreSQL提供pg_concurrency_control插件,用于对SQL进行并发控制。前提条件 RDS PostgreSQL实例版本为PostgreSQL 10或11。参数说明 参数 默认值 说明 pg_concurrency_control.query_concurrency 0 设置Select类型SQL并发控制的排队...
关闭或重新开启 扫描并发控制功能 扫描并发控制功能默认开启,您可以通过 下列命令关闭或重新开启 扫描并发控制 功能。集群级别 关闭或重新开启 扫描并发控制功能:SET ADB_CONFIG SPLIT_FLOW_CONTROL_ENABLED=true|false;查询级别 关闭或...
本文通过ECS(Elastic Compute Service)访问云数据库MongoDB,测试云数据库MongoDB单节点实例的高连接能力。准备工作 创建ECS实例和云数据库MongoDB单节点实例。如何创建,请参见 创建单节点实例 和 创建ECS实例。本测试的实例配置如下:...
阿里云关系型数据库RDS(Relational Database Service)是一种安全稳定可靠、高性价比、可弹性伸缩的在线数据库服务。RDS支持MySQL、SQL Server、PostgreSQL和MariaDB引擎,并且提供了容灾、备份、恢复、监控、迁移等方面的全套解决方案,...
为了方便您的使用,我们也提供了可直接使用的并发调用方式,相关的并发控制由 SDK 内部实现。最大并发数 poolSize:=2/可缓存的最大请求数 maxTaskQueueSize:=5/在创建时开启异步功能 config:=sdk.NewConfig().WithEnableAsync(true)....
Fast Query Cache 针对原生MySQL Query Cache的不足,阿里云进行重新设计和全新实现,推出Fast Query Cache,优化并发控制、内存管理和缓存机制,能够有效提高数据库查询性能。Binlog in Redo Binlog in Redo功能指在事务提交时将Binlog...
并发控制 场景说明 一个服务常常会调用别的模块,可能是另外一个远程服务、数据库,或者第三方API等。例如,支付的时候,可能需要远程调用银联提供的API;查询某个商品的价格,可能需要进行数据库查询。然而,这个被依赖服务的稳定性是不能...
控制资源使用 通过限制某类SQL的并发数,控制数据库资源的使用量,避免资源耗尽导致数据库崩溃或者性能下降。例如在数据库备份、恢复、监控等SQL操作时,为了避免其对数据库性能的影响,可以使用SQL限流控制相关操作的速度。前提条件 RDS ...
控制资源使用 通过限制某类SQL的并发数,控制数据库资源的使用量,避免资源耗尽导致数据库崩溃或者性能下降。例如在数据库备份、恢复、监控等SQL操作时,为了避免其对数据库性能的影响,可以使用SQL限流控制相关操作的速度。前提条件 RDS ...
PolarDB PostgreSQL版(兼容Oracle)提供全面的Oracle语法兼容性,采用share everything架构,与Oracle保持一致文件组织架构与多版本并发控制,提供常用Oracle语法支持及Oracle常用特性支持以及OCI原生接口,全面支持助力一键从Oracle迁移...
问题原因 MaxCompute没有并发控制,可能有多个任务在修改这张表。这种情况下,有极小的概率在最后的META操作时,发生并发冲突导致执行异常。同时ALTER、INSERT操作都会发生此情况。解决方案 建议您将此表修改为分区表,每个SQL语句插入的...
说明 详情请参考Databricks官网文章:并发控制。Delta Lake在读取和写入之间提供ACID事务保证。这意味着:跨多个集群的多个编写器可以同时修改表分区,并查看表的一致性快照视图,并且这些写入操作将具有序列顺序。即使在作业过程中修改了...
SQL执行前目标资源并发控制 DMS系统自适应默认开启,DMS将控制通过DMS同一时间执行的SQL数量。SQL执行前数据库负载检查 线程数检查保护机制默认开启,如果数据库负载过高,暂停执行SQL。您可以设置允许最大运行中的线程数量、失败时重试的...
通过OOS定时进行带宽的临时升级。背景 当您需进行带宽临时升级时,通过OOS 带宽临时升级 可轻松搞定...并发速率 可以选择 并发控制 和 批次控制,本示例选择 并发控制。此时在右下角可查看到带宽收费参考,如了解收费情况后,单击 立即执行。
对DTT(Delta Transactional Table)的所有数据修改操作,都会由MetaService统一进行事务管理,满足ACID特性,应用MVCC模型来保障读写快照隔离,采用OCC模型进行乐观事务并发控制。冲突检测规则 下表为作业并发提交场景下,对同一个非分区...
若选择 批次控制,您需要设置 批次速率数组、循环并发控制 和 最大错误次数 等参数信息。在 OOS扮演的RAM角色 处,选择RAM角色。任务设置 在 任务描述 区域,设置任务的简要描述。单击 下一步。在 确定 页签中,查看批量升级设置的基本信息...
原子性(Atomicity)一致性(Consistency)隔离性(Isolation)持久性(Durability)PolarDB-X 通过引入中心授时服务(TSO),结合多版本并发控制(MVCC),确保读取到一致的快照,而不会读到事务的中间状态。如下图所示,提交事务时,计算...
功能简介 PolarDB MySQL版 多主集群是MySQL生态下业内首个透明行级多写数据库集群。可以在保持单机事务体验不变的基础上,实现跨机的横向写扩展。用户无需任何表结构改造,也不会出现乐观冲突的死锁报错。为了保证多个主节点可以实时更新...
Interactive型资源组的优先级队列与并发控制 XIHE_ENV_QUERY_ETL_MAX_QUEUED_SIZE 单个前端节点LOWEST队列的最大可排队查询数,默认值为200。SET ADB_CONFIG XIHE_ENV_QUERY_ETL_MAX_QUEUED_SIZE=200;XIHE_ENV_QUERY_LOW_PRIORITY_MAX_...
支持 支持 支持 Statement Concurrency Control 提供基于语句规则的并发控制CCL(Concurrency Control),并提供了工具包(DBMS_CCL)便于您快捷使用。支持 支持 不支持 Performance Agent 便捷的性能数据统计方案。通过MySQL插件的方式,...
这是因为把标准隔离级别映射到 PostgreSQL 的多版本并发控制架构的唯一合理的方法。该表格也显示 PostgreSQL 的可重复读实现不允许幻读。而 SQL 标准允许更严格的行为:四种隔离级别只定义了哪种现像不能发生,但是没有定义哪种现像 必须 ...
阿里云RDS的线程池实现了不同类型SQL操作的优先级及并发控制机制,将连接数始终控制在最佳连接数附近,使RDS数据库在高连接大并发情况下始终保持高性能。线程池的优势如下:当大量线程并发工作时,线程池会自动调节并发的线程数量在合理的...
同时逻辑中需要包含大量的代码以及更复杂的并发控制逻辑。网络流量 触发器在数据库的内部处理数据。非触发器需要订阅事件流以及回写数据,这将使用到主机间的流量,占用MySQL的进程流量。代码的复杂性依赖缜密的算法逻辑,完善的测试用例集...
AnalyticDB PostgreSQL版 数据库使用PostgreSQL多版本并发控制(MVCC)来管理并发事务,底层表的储存数据被划分成固定大小的Page,默认Page大小为32 KB。每个Page包含Header(数据头)、Item pointer array(指向内部数据的指针数组)、...
并发控制与熔断规则 场景说明 一个服务常常会调用别的模块,可能是另外一个远程服务、数据库,或者第三方API等。例如,支付的时候,可能需要远程调用银联提供的API;查询某个商品的价格,可能需要进行数据库查询。然而,这个被依赖服务的...
本文档介绍PolarDB云数据库的性能优点以及共享存储、物理复制和使用场景中优化的过程。背景信息 传统的关系型数据库有着悠久的历史,从上世纪60年代开始就已经在航空领域发挥作用。因为其严谨的一致性保证以及通用的关系型数据模型接口,...